Definition of parental kidnapping
Parental kidnapping is when one parent takes their child without permission from the other parent who has custody or visitation rights. This is against the law and can have serious consequences.
- A mother takes her child to another state without telling the father who has visitation rights.
- A father refuses to return his child to the mother after a weekend visit.
These examples illustrate how one parent is taking the child without the other parent's permission, which is considered kidnapping.

Simple Definition
Parental kidnapping is when one parent takes a child away from the other parent without permission. This is against the law and can cause a lot of problems for the child and both parents. It's important for parents to follow custody and visitation agreements to avoid parental kidnapping.
